Department Overview

The System Performance, Reliability and Resiliency Strategy team within the overall Electric Transmission and Distribution Engineering organization is responsible for planning, organizing, and managing the resources necessary to successfully execute PG&E’s Electric Reliability Strategy and initiatives. This team of forward–thinking individuals will be tasked with deploying technology and infrastructure and influencing the organization to achieve the company’s reliability goals. The team is responsible for implementing programs required to modernize the electric grid allowing for safe, resilient and efficient operations. The team participates in a cross functional team of internal and consulting participants being tasked with leading the transition of a project from development and testing to being operational for each phase of each project.

Position Summary

Within the System Performance, Reliability and Resiliency Strategy team, this position reports to the Senior Manager of Reliability Analytics and is responsible for developing advanced data science models and industry-leading anomaly detection techniques to identify potential failures and enhance the reliability of the electric transmission and distribution grid.

Key responsibilities include designing, developing, and executing scripts, programs, models, algorithms, and processes using structured and unstructured data from diverse sources and of varying sizes. The goal is to generate defensible, valid, scalable, reproducible, and well-documented machine learning and artificial intelligence models (predictive or optimization) to support problem-solving and strategic decision-making.

The role also involves active participation in internal and external communities of practice in data science, AI, and machine learning to stay current and contribute to advancements in the field. Additionally, the candidate will help educate non-technical stakeholders on the benefits, limitations, and maturity of data science solutions.

In this role, the successful candidate will be uniquely positioned at the forefront of utility industry analytics. Working as part of cross-functional teams, including data engineers, data scientists, technologists, and subject matter experts – this individual will lead the development of data science capabilities that could lead to paradigm changes in how the utility operates.

    Job Responsibilities

  • Lead research and development of state-of-the-art methodologies to detect potential system failures and improve the reliability of the electric transmission and distribution grid.
  • Applies data science/ machine learning /artificial intelligence methods to develop scalable, defensible and reproducible models,
  • Serves as the technical lead for the development of predictive/reliability analytics models.
  • Develops python codes for data processing and data science model developments (e.g., ML/AI models, advanced statistical models)
  • Documents datasets, modeling processes, and result to ensure transparency, reproducibility, and defensibility.
  • Contribute to the development of data science strategies aligned with system performance, reliability, and resiliency team goals.
  • Communicate technical concepts and model results to internal/external stakeholders.
Qualifications Minimum:
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Data Science, Machine Learning, Computer Science, Physics, Econometrics or Economics, Engineering, Mathematics, Applied Sciences, Statistics, or equivalent field
  • 4 years in data science OR 2 years, if possess Master’s Degree, as described above
